We had a beautiful afternoon trip filled with hundreds of Common dolphins! We raced out to the SW and were almost to the 9-mile bank when we started to see an uptick in bird and splash activity! We surveyed the super calm seas in search for our 3 S’s: spouts, splashes and seabirds! We sighted a small pod of Common dolphins but then spotted a larger pod out in the distance to the south! We made a good choice as that pod was massive! There was around ~700 Long-beaked Common dolphins! They were coming from the south going to the NW. We came across a dense aggregation of a couple hundred that swarmed our boat! Many surfed our wake and jumped in and out of the water all around us! We got great looks at small calves that cruised close to mom. As the dolphins rushed the area, we also got fun looks at 3 flying fish that got spooked and glided away!
